Burgos’ signature blood sausage made with rice, onion, and spices. It is one of the city’s most iconic traditional foods and is served grilled, fried, or in tapas.
A fresh, mild white cheese traditionally made in the province. It is prized for its soft texture and is commonly eaten as a starter or dessert.
Roast milk-fed lamb, usually cooked slowly in a wood-fired oven. This Castilian classic is especially associated with Burgos and nearby roasting houses.

Generally affordable by Spanish city standards. Tapas, coffee, and local menus are reasonable, while hotels rise in peak summer and holiday periods.
Tipping is modest. Round up or leave EUR 1-2 in cafes and casual bars. In restaurants, 5-10% is appreciated for good service but not expected. Taxis are usually rounded up.
